2017.0309.数字电路与系统

时间:2022-08-11 19:17:15

译码器

1.二-十进制译码器,是四个输入端,十个输出端,在这之前没有与之对应的编码器。将BCD码输入是什么意思?这里说完全对应BCD码

这里对于二-十进制译码器的不理解,源于早期数值与码制内容学习的不扎实,这是一种用二进制表示其他进制的内容。

以四位二进制数表示一位十进制数的数制叫做二-十进制。其实这产生了一种浪费,四位多了,三位二进制又无法表示0-9这十位数字。并没有用完所有的四位二进制数,只用了前十位,二-十进制是一种有权码,也称为8421BCD码,剩余的没用的六个二进制数称为伪码。

2.显示译码器

常见的显示器件是七段显示器件,八段的显示器件是在右下角有一个小数点。七段的排序是顺时针,最后到中间一横。七段显示译码器是由七个二极管组成的,可以是共阴,也可以是共阳连接。

总结:译码器部分掌握不是很熟悉,还需后续的了解,尤其是显示译码器,我总觉着译码器应该和编码器对应的很好,但是现在还没有这样的感觉。

数据选择器

1.数据选择器,重点在于选择,能够在一组输入的数据中,选择出自己所需要的那一个数据,并将其输出。“能选择” “能输出”

这相当于多路到一路的开关?看视频时,讲解为有一组n个输入的数据,相当于开关的一个接口,右侧的输出相当于开关的闸刀,闸刀放到哪个输入数据上,该数据就被选中且输出。整个过程非常像断开开关的闭合过程。

2.假设数据选择有八个数据输入端,输出端要起到选择控制的作用,那么输出必须是三位二进制。

3. 数据选择器是将众多低速输入数据整合成一路高速信号,输出信号是截取众多输入的信号的一部分,只是这些部分是不同时间段的。比如,首先在第一个输入数据上截取,然后在第二个输入数据上截取,依次类推。但是这里要问一下所有的输入信号是稳定的么?

低速电路是指低频的么?

4.数据选择器的两边的端口称为数据端和地址端,开始以为两个端口是输入和输出,在看逻辑图时,数据端和地址端都是输入端,输出端另有安排。数据端是输入所有的数据,但是具体输出那个数据,这时候需要地址端来起到选择控制的作用。

5.数据选择器和之前的编码器,译码器都是不一样的,但是贯穿三个仪器的共同点就是最小项,这个最小项如何组合安排,每个仪器有所不同。而且,这些仪器都会拥有一些使能端,起到控制仪器能否工作和扩展仪器。

6.数据选择器的器件有74153型双四选一多路选择器,以及74151八选一多路数据选择器。一个是双四选一,一个是八选一。

7.地址端起到了控制开关选择哪个数据输出的作用。数据选择器的使能端只有一个,比之前译码器的使能端简洁的多。数据选择没怎么谈有效电平,即使有也仅针对唯一的使能端来说的,这个使能端是反变量来表示的。反变量输入是0,即低电平有效时,数据选择器才会工作。

8.八选一数据选择器的输出端挺特别,配备了两个输出端,两者互成反变量。有什么作用?

数据选择器的输出端表达式同时包括地址端和数据端,两者相与,起到选择控制作用。地址端还存在一个高低的问题?排序?

9.讲到运用数据选择器可以用来实现逻辑函数,之前没什么深刻的认识,现在明白了,我们可以借助一些现有的集成模块来实现原先设计好的逻辑函数逻辑功能。包括之前的译码器也是。我们不可能自己一根一根地搭建线路,利用现有的集成电路完成给定的任务,才是可行的。或者说,如果某一设定的函数能够大规模地运用,那我们可以制备新的简化好的集成电路,大批量的的生产才能减少设计一个新的集成模块的成本。这一切有一个前提,函数的变量和数据选择器的控制端数目(地址端)是一样的。

10.假设下,逻辑函数变量的数目多于地址端的数目应该怎么办?扩展原有的数据选择器,将八选一变成十六选一。突然概念有些模糊,八选一和十六选一的一是什么?一定要牢记,这是数据选择器,选一就是选择一个数据输入端,但是在实现函数表达式。

第二种方法是简化逻辑函数表达式,削减变量的个数。采用卡诺图降掉一个维数,我的理解是将多余的变量当成常量来看待,使剩余的变量和地址端数目一致。

关于卡诺图法降维数,这里是采用了一个公式,但是为什么能够采用公式?如果能够采用公式,为什么公式是这样的?

数据分配器